Energy can mold liquid—particularly liquids with invisible particles dissolved into their essence—into any shape and texture. It can change its tensile strength, its hardness, and its durability. You can control this energy, and therefore can craft liquid more precisely and much more instantaneously than a craftsman shapes wood or stone. You can take a bit of water, infuse it with nanoscopic particles, and make it into a sword, a jerkin, a rope, or—eventually—a wall or even a cypher with moving parts and complex circuitry.
Nanos make the most obvious liquid shapers, but any character can benefit from these abilities. A Glaive that can create their own weapons or a Jack who can instantly have any tool they need would certainly have an advantage.
You very likely carry a large container with liquid in it wherever you go.

Tier 2: Condensation (2 Intellect points). You
transform the air into liquid, creating up to 100 gallons (380 liters). Action.
Create Liquid Wall (2 Intellect points). You
shape about 100 gallons (380 liters) of water into a wall about 10 feet (3 m) by 10 feet (3 m) by 1 foot (30 cm). This wall is level 4. Alternatively, you can shape the liquid into a single shape of about the same mass: a ladder 100 feet (30 m) tall, a barred cage about 8 feet (2 m) to a side, or a rope 500 feet (150 m) long. It lasts one hour. Action.
Tier 3: Sturdier Liquid Creations. When you
use one of the tier 1 or tier 2 abilities, the level of the item you create is two levels higher. Enabler.
Tier 4: Create Complex Liquid Item (5 Intellect points). You can shape about a
gallon of liquid into a complex device— anything from a crossbow to a cypher. The device is the size of something you can easily hold in one hand. In order to make something like a cypher, you must have an example of the cypher you want to make in your possession, and you must make a numenera-based Intellect roll with a difficulty equal to the level of the cypher. The created cypher is two levels lower than the actual cypher (minimum 1).
You could also make a needed part for a numenera device more permanent or sophisticated than a cypher, like an artifact or larger/more complex device. You could not make a complete device. While you do not need to have the part in your possession, the difficulty of the task is still 2 higher than the level of the item.
In any case, the item lasts one hour. Action.
Tier 5: Create Liquid Structure (5 Intellect points). You can shape a large amount of
liquid into a large structure—about 1,000 gallons (3,800 liters) needed for a 10-foot (3 m) cube. Your creation can be as large as ten such cubes, if you have the liquid available. Tier 1: Create Liquid Item (1 Intellect point).
You can shape about a gallon of liquid into any simple item (no moving parts) that you can easily hold in one hand. The item is level 2, but has the appropriate density (so a liquid sword can be used as a weapon) and lasts for one hour. Action.
